Croatia Airlines is to launch a direct flight from Zagreb to Sofia, the business portal for monitoring world routes Routes Onlines reports. The Zagreb-Sofia flights start from May 1 and will be operated seasonally until the end of October. The flights will be available three times a week - Monday, Wednesday and Friday - and will be operated by Havilland Dash 8-400 aircraft, with 76 seats.
Croatia Airlines will also launch direct flights to the capital of Monte Negro, Podgorica.
